Full Definition of ELM

1
:  any of a genus (Ulmus of the family Ulmaceae, the elm family) of usually large deciduous north temperate-zone trees with alternate stipulate leaves and fruit that is a samara
2
:  the wood of an elm

Origin of ELM

Middle English, from Old English; akin to Old High German elme elm, Latin ulmus
First Known Use: before 12th century
